Jana, Elisa & Bettina took advantage of the lets offer from their employer and signed up for a social day at the animal shelter in Munich.

The day was full of animal impressions and was a lot of fun for everyone involved. Here they tell us why they signed up for Social Day and what they take away from it.

Why did you participate in the project?

J.: Because I generally like working with animals and have already walked/run dogs in the shelter.

E: Because I think it's great that we can get involved socially and care about animals.

B: I wanted to make use of the LETS offer and the shelter project was recommended to me by a colleague (we wanted to do that together 😊)

 

What did you particularly like?

J: At the beginning, the nurse took a lot of time to give us an insight into the history of the shelter. He also told us a lot about where the animals come from, etc. In the end, we were allowed to visit the cat & small animal house.

On this day, we dug up 3 dog enclosures and “remade” them. Physical work was a great balance compared to everyday office life.

E: That we got an insight into how much work is being done at the Munich animal shelter, how many animals are currently looking for a new home there and that we have received a lot of information.

B: The appreciative nature of our AP in the shelter, how well we worked together as a group, a nice day outside the office where you could do other activities, great organization

 How important is volunteer work to you?

J: I find it very appreciative and great that my company is providing 3 special vacation days for volunteer work.

Volunteering (even in my free time) is very important to me.

E: Very important, I think it's great that my employer offers their employees the opportunity to have a Social Day.

B: Important, I just don't take the time to do this often enough. That's why I find the offer here so great, because you can try out different things and the offer is very low-threshold.

 

What are you taking away from the project?

J: That I go to animal shelters more often on weekends and walk dogs. And that I'll sign up for the next project right away 😉

E: That many animals are looking for a new home and that the shelter is doing a great job.

B: That I would like to get involved in a project again, how much effort it takes to keep an animal shelter running and how valuable the support of volunteers is.
